We lived long together
a life filled,
if you will,
with flowers. So that
I was cheered
when I came first to know
that there were flowers also
in hell.
William Carlos Williams

Usually, the limiting factor for roses is water. If the rose is not getting enough water, it will let you know. Bent neck is the common sign that water uptake is not adequate, and the upper stem bends over because it is the weakest part.
Kathleen Brown
